the 'motor' decides in which direction the electrons go. a battery as a 'motor' moves the electrons in just one direction -> DC. on the minus side are many electrons, on the plus side there are just a few. If you connect both ends with a conductive enough material, the electrons try to spread out equally between both points. that means, electrons rush from the minus side to plus. voilà Direct Current
AC happens, when your motor is a spinning magnet next to a conductive material. the electric feld of the spinning magnet pushes the electrons back and forth in the conductor -> AC.
